Web12 de feb. de 2024 · The Trash on Mac OS X can only work, if no data is actually deleted, thus no new data can be written over the "place" where the data in the Trash bin actually resides on. By emptying the Trash you tell the OS, it is okay to use the "place" the older and now completely deleted data used to reside in, as that place is now empty. One simple way was already … Web9 de nov. de 2024 · Open Trash on Mac. Right click any blank area or click while holding the Control key. Select Empty Trash from the context menu. Click Empty Trash again in a prompt window. Three: Look for the Trash icon in your Dock. Right click on the icon or click it while holding the Control key. Choose Empty Trash from the menu that appeared.
